The definition of the following terms are :-

Constrict - process of binding or contracting, becoming narrowed.

Cyclopegic - is paralysis of the ciliary muscle of the eye, resulting in a loss of accommodation.

Dilate - The process of enlargement, stretching, or expansion

Gluacoma - is defined as raised intraocular pressure

Intracameral - means within a chamber, such as the anterior or posterior chamber of the eye.

IOP - intraocular pressure . The pressure created by fluids within the eyes

Miotic - constriction of pupils

Mydriatric - dilation of pupils

Phacoemulsification - a cataract operation in which the diseased lens is reduced to a liquid by ultrasonic vibrations and drained out of the eye.
